Hi guys, how can I add in my contact child,father,brother for siri. I did it on mine 4's but can't do it on my wife new phone I got for her today. I already told siri " Lucia "is my daughter but when I go to my wife contact is default under manager. WTF. BTW my wife new phone is under 5.0.1 software if that help
 
Where are the contacts stored? If they're in google, yahoo, or etc. then they don't have the needed options. You'll need to use iCloud.

I don't think iCloud is needed. But I do know that the can't be setup correctly when syncing via Google or Yahoo. So far I've tested an Exchange 2007 account, works and no contact syncing on iOS 5, works. But Snow Leopard's Address Book doesn't seem to like the "Related People" field very much.
